Only one problem
I live in Maine. I am on a flat land area where a river and a railroad track funnel north and west winds right up our long driveway and across our fields. I looked for a jacket to wear with snowpants that could stop wind. This jacket is perfect for that. Wind does not go through this unless its well over 20 mph. At that point I'm not out there anyway! However it is not necessarily a warm jacket. I wear a zippered fleece-lined hoody underneath to supply warmth and with the wind stopping capability I've been out in -15F windchill comfortably.
My problem is that after owning this coat for several winters, using it at least three times a day from December through March, the zipper is failing. It's getting worn around the bottom making it hard to put the zipper together and zip up. I would love a zipper from the manufacturer, but am afraid I will have to settle for store bought. The rest of the coat shows no wear, looks new and I rely on it everyday. Highly recommend it.
